#include <DHT.h>
#define NODE 2
#if NODE == 1
#define MQ2_PIN 34
void setup() {
Serial.begin(115200);
delay(1000);
Serial2.begin(9600, SERIAL_8N1, 16, 17);
Serial.println("Gas Node ready");
}
void loop() {
int gasRaw = analogRead(MQ2_PIN);
Serial.print("Gas (raw): ");
Serial.println(gasRaw);
Serial2.println(gasRaw);
delay(2000);
}
#elif NODE == 2
#define DHT_PIN 15
#define DHT_TYPE DHT22
DHT dht(DHT_PIN, DHT_TYPE);
void setup() {
Serial.begin(115200);
delay(1000);
Serial2.begin(9600, SERIAL_8N1, 16, 17);
dht.begin();
Serial.println("Climate Node ready");
}
void loop() {
float temperature = dht.readTemperature();
float humidity = dht.readHumidity();
if (isnan(temperature) || isnan(humidity)) {
Serial.println("DHT read error!");
} else {
Serial.print("Temp: "); Serial.print(temperature); Serial.println(" C");
Serial.print("Humidity: "); Serial.print(humidity); Serial.println(" %");
}
if (Serial2.available()) {
String gasData = Serial2.readStringUntil('\n');
Serial.print("Gas from ESP32 #1: ");
Serial.println(gasData);
}
delay(2000);
}
#endif
